2002-12-13 |
Misha Brukman | Cleaned up the code: factored out switch/case into... |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Need to insert all moves due to PHI nodes before *ALL... |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Insert phi code at top of block |
tree | commitdiff |
2002-12-13 |
Brian Gaeke | lib/Target/X86/InstSelectSimple.cpp: |
tree | commitdiff |
2002-12-13 |
Misha Brukman | This should be more correct: invalidates physical regis... |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Implement cast bool to X |
tree | commitdiff |
2002-12-13 |
Brian Gaeke | Rename all BMI MachineBasicBlock operands to MBB. |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Finish up iterator stuph |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Treat longs as ints => pretend they're all 32-bit value... |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Fixed bug with running out of registers. Also, reinstat... |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Code gen phi's correctly |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Print X86 PHI nodes in a sane manner |
tree | commitdiff |
2002-12-13 |
Misha Brukman | This should handle register allocating PHI nodes. |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Added moveReg2Reg() and moveImm2Reg() to accomodate... |
tree | commitdiff |
2002-12-13 |
Brian Gaeke | lib/Target/X86/InstSelectSimple.cpp: Start counting... |
tree | commitdiff |
2002-12-13 |
Brian Gaeke | InstSelectSimple.cpp: Give promote32 a comment. Add... |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Implement getelementptr constant exprs |
tree | commitdiff |
2002-12-13 |
Brian Gaeke | brg |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Emit the right form of mod/rm mod field |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Nicify a bit |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Fix encoding of CBW instruction |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Start allocating stack space at [ebp-4] to not overwrit... |
tree | commitdiff |
2002-12-13 |
Misha Brukman | Moves now select correct opcode based on the data size. |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Remove extranous #include |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Rename MemArg* to Arg* |
tree | commitdiff |
2002-12-13 |
Chris Lattner | Make mem size an assert |
tree | commitdiff |
2002-12-13 |
Misha Brukman | This is supposed to provide correct size for datatypes... |
tree | commitdiff |
2002-12-12 |
Misha Brukman | Take advantage of our knowledge of 2-address X86 instru... |
tree | commitdiff |
2002-12-12 |
Misha Brukman | Added the flag to mark instructions which are really... |
tree | commitdiff |
2002-12-12 |
Brian Gaeke | This checkin is brought to you by the brian gaeke allni... |
tree | commitdiff |
2002-12-12 |
Misha Brukman | 'graph' is spelled without a 'c'. |
tree | commitdiff |
2002-12-12 |
Chris Lattner | Remove #includes |
tree | commitdiff |
2002-12-10 |
Vikram S. Adve | External routines used to identify Cilk operations... |
tree | commitdiff |
2002-12-10 |
Vikram S. Adve | This file implements the function DemoteRegToStack... |
tree | commitdiff |
2002-12-10 |
Vikram S. Adve | This file implements a pass that automatically parallel... |
tree | commitdiff |
2002-12-08 |
Vikram S. Adve | Iterator that enumerates the ProgramDependenceGraph... |
tree | commitdiff |
2002-12-08 |
Vikram S. Adve | An explicit representation of dependence graphs, and... |
tree | commitdiff |
2002-12-08 |
Chris Lattner | Namespacify more |
tree | commitdiff |
2002-12-08 |
Chris Lattner | Add support to count the number of dynamic instructions... |
tree | commitdiff |
2002-12-07 |
Chris Lattner | Add total instruction, bb, & function counts |
tree | commitdiff |
2002-12-07 |
Chris Lattner | Fix bug that was bugging bugpoint |
tree | commitdiff |
2002-12-07 |
Chris Lattner | Remove dead code |
tree | commitdiff |
2002-12-06 |
Vikram S. Adve | Two bug fixes: |
tree | commitdiff |
2002-12-06 |
Vikram S. Adve | Fix several related bugs in DSNode::mergeWith() caused... |
tree | commitdiff |
2002-12-06 |
Brian Gaeke | Implement a lot of cast functionality (no FP or 64) |
tree | commitdiff |
2002-12-05 |
Chris Lattner | Fix bug: 2002-12-05-MissedConstProp.ll pointed out... |
tree | commitdiff |
2002-12-05 |
Vikram S. Adve | Cute bug fix: when moving links from N to this, some... |
tree | commitdiff |
2002-12-05 |
Brian Gaeke | Target/X86/Printer.cpp: Add sizePtr function, and use... |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Added code generation for function prologues and epilogues. |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Implemented functions for emitting prologues and epilogues; |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Added push and pop instructions. |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Fix handling of function calls that return void |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Implement initial support for return values from call... |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Fun arithmetic with iterators aimed at fixing a bug... |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Adjust the stack pointer after a function call, proport... |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Added instructions to add/subtract imm32 to/from a... |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Fix bogus assertion failures |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Avoid bad assertion |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Remove think-o assertion |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Avoid crashing on Arguments, just silently miscompile |
tree | commitdiff |
2002-12-04 |
Misha Brukman | storeReg2RegOffset() and loadRegOffset2Reg() now take... |
tree | commitdiff |
2002-12-04 |
Misha Brukman | Moved buildReg2RegClassMap() into from X86RegisterInfo... |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Add a "Lazy Function Resolution in Jello" section |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Fix a bug I introduced in a previous change |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Add support for referencing global variables/functions |
tree | commitdiff |
2002-12-04 |
Chris Lattner | Print out direct global references |
tree | commitdiff |
2002-12-03 |
Misha Brukman | This should fix the bug seen with some registers not... |
tree | commitdiff |
2002-12-03 |
Misha Brukman | Added support for callee- and caller-save registers. |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Fix broken ret opcode, grr... |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Checkin debug implementation of MCE |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Fix instsel for calls |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Simplify code |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Fix big bug introduced with symbol table changes |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Fix the build |
tree | commitdiff |
2002-12-03 |
Brian Gaeke | brg |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Split the machine code emitter completely out of the... |
tree | commitdiff |
2002-12-03 |
Chris Lattner | * Move information about Implicit Defs/Uses into X86Ins... |
tree | commitdiff |
2002-12-03 |
Chris Lattner | Initialize implicit uses/defs fields for sparc backend... |
tree | commitdiff |
2002-12-03 |
Brian Gaeke | brg |
tree | commitdiff |
2002-12-02 |
Chris Lattner | More support for machine code emission: raw instructions |
tree | commitdiff |
2002-12-02 |
Chris Lattner | Expose explicit type |
tree | commitdiff |
2002-12-02 |
Chris Lattner | Start implementing MachineCodeEmitter |
tree | commitdiff |
2002-12-02 |
Chris Lattner | Eliminate OtherFrm |
tree | commitdiff |
2002-12-02 |
Chris Lattner | Remove comment |
tree | commitdiff |
2002-12-02 |
Chris Lattner | Initial support for machine code emission |
tree | commitdiff |
2002-12-02 |
Misha Brukman | Ignore generated files Lexer.cpp and llvmAsmParser.* |
tree | commitdiff |
2002-12-02 |
Misha Brukman | * Abstracted out stack space allocation into its own... |
tree | commitdiff |
2002-12-02 |
Misha Brukman | Fix order of operands on a store from reg to [reg+offset]. |
tree | commitdiff |
2002-12-01 |
Chris Lattner | Add rawfrm flags |
tree | commitdiff |
2002-12-01 |
Chris Lattner | Don't add implicit regs |
tree | commitdiff |
2002-11-30 |
Brian Gaeke | brg |
tree | commitdiff |
2002-11-29 |
Brian Gaeke | brg |
tree | commitdiff |
2002-11-27 |
Vikram S. Adve | Fix logical error in TD pass: we should clear Mod/Ref... |
tree | commitdiff |
2002-11-27 |
Vikram S. Adve | (1) Bug fix that was causing nodes with dangling refere... |
tree | commitdiff |
2002-11-26 |
Brian Gaeke | brg |
tree | commitdiff |
2002-11-25 |
Vikram S. Adve | Keep global nodes in each DS Graph (by forcing them... |
tree | commitdiff |
2002-11-22 |
Misha Brukman | Oops. Got the MOVrm and MOVmr mixed up. Fixed. We can... |
tree | commitdiff |
2002-11-22 |
Misha Brukman | Enable the register allocator pass. |
tree | commitdiff |
2002-11-22 |
Misha Brukman | A simple (spilling) register allocator. |
tree | commitdiff |
2002-11-22 |
Misha Brukman | Added methods to read/write values to stack in .h,... |
tree | commitdiff |
next |